This episode features a conversation with Dark Delicacies co-founder and author Del Howison on the history of his beloved shop in Burbank as it rounds the corner toward its final day in April after decades of serving West coast genre fans with books, movies, collectibles, and unforgettable signing events. Del and I discuss the origin of the store, his inspiring relationship with wife and co-founder Sue Howison, and what it has meant to them to be so ingrained in the world of genre entertainment. Del also gets into his process as a prolific writer, and much more. In 2012 I had the honor of contributing to the KISS tourbook/magazine for their then-forthcoming album Monster and corresponding tour, and for the project I did a retrospective on their 1978 Hanna-Barbera-produced TV movie KISS MEETS THE PHANTOM OF THE PARK. For the piece I interviewed director Gordon Hessler, star Anthony Zerbe, producer Terry Morse Jr. and Gene Simmons, and in this episode of the Radio Hour I present those never-before-heard interviews as originally recorded, along with input from Ace Frehley, Paul Stanley, and Peter Criss on what was a wild production at a pivotal moment in the band's career. I dive deep on historical context of where the band was at this moment, their zenith. It is a fascinating examination of an under-explored made-for-TV gem from one of rock's most enduring acts.

Episode 41 features an archival interview with director Michael Cooney on his 1997 direct-to-video winter classic JACK FROST. Michael and I talk through the production of the film, the snowman costume fail that led to the movie's humor, the 1998 sequel, and he breaks down the third JACK FROST film he would still love to make. Anthony C. Ferrante then joins me for a discussion of his favorite physical media releases of 2024, followed by listener voicemails and social media responses on the topic. On this episode I chat with Michael and Jason Leavy who are part of the team behind the TERRIFIER films, STREAM, the upcoming SCREAMBOAT, and their company Fuzz on the Lens Productions. We dive deep on their early film work, their Staten Island Clown prank that ended up getting national attention, working with cinema icons on their earlier feature ABNORMAL ATTRACTION, and of course the whole world of TERRIFIER and the family that has created these films that have revolutionized the industry by chainsawing through doors for independent cinema.
